Great Lakes Relay

The Great Lakes Relay is a multi-day team running event held in Michigan. Founded in 1992, the event is organized as a three day relay for teams of ten runners and takes place across trails and roads described by the organizer as Michigan’s outback. The event emphasizes outdoor fitness, teamwork, and community engagement.

The relay includes division competition with traveling trophies awarded to division winners. The 2026 event named champions in the Mixed Division and the Open Division and published event results. The organizer lists sponsors that support the event.

Proceeds from the relay are used to support the Michigan Special Olympics and a range of local organizations. The event statement notes values of community, integrity, and sustainability and describes an event structure that spans three days of sequential legs run by team members. The organizer provides a team registration process and posts results after the event.
